Biography

Ole Bratt Birkeland is a cinematographer, also credited as Ole Birkeland. He has worked as director of photography on the television series The Crown (2016), Utopia (2013), His Dark Materials (2019), Tales from the Loop (2020) and Philip K. Dick's Electric Dreams (2017), and on the films American Animals (2018), Judy (2019), Ticket to Paradise (2022), Ghost Stories (2018) and The Little Stranger (2018).

Birkeland served as director of photography on the 2026 series Dear England. He is a member of the British Society of Cinematographers and has received BAFTA nominations for his work on Utopia and National Treasure, as well as British Independent Film Award nominations for American Animals and Judy.
